Internships Opportunities

No, there is no internship. No stipend. Nothing in this college. In my course not even one company comes and visits the campus for the placement interview instead only one company I.e. Syntel had said the college to send the students to the company itself. They did not even visit the campus.

Placement Experience

0.5

While taking admission in this college, they'll tell you that you'll get placements through the college and many companies but these are all lies. No company visits the campus for the placement interview regarding (BSc Computer Science). And there are no job opportunities by studying through this college.

Fee Structure And Facilities

The fee according to the infrastructure and study point of view is bit expensive.The fees for the first year is around Rs.40,000 which can be paid in 4 installments. The fees for the second & third year is around Rs.37,000 which can again be paid in 4 installments. If delayed, will be fined of Rs. 200 additionally.

Fees and Financial Aid

There was loan facility available but I do not have any idea about it much though. But the college provided some scholarship for the meritorious students through the university. And to the lower caste too, that also through the university itself. The college themselves dis not provide any scholarship.

Exam Structure

The exam structure of the college is that the first year is internal I.e. they'll give marks through their college itself and its an annual pattern. But in the second & third year, the exams are held semi annually.

Admission

I got my admission in this college through giving a personal interview (PI) with Principal and HOD of the college staff. They were easy enough. Then I just paid the fees and got into the college without any further obstructions.
